HIP 28095

HIP 28095 is a F-type (Yellow-White) star.

Located approximately 756.7 light-years from Earth, HIP 28095 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 28095 is classified as a spectral class F star (F-type (Yellow-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

At an apparent magnitude of +10.07, HIP 28095 is a faint star that requires a telescope to observe. It is invisible to the naked eye and too dim for most binoculars.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.466.
